Output 3828f766fffede67b5bbcba2a768bd6fce5b292ca2d7eefdeb5faa80f93b1589:11

value
2303993
script pubkey
OP_0 OP_PUSHBYTES_20 5bfa26ce4b4bff2aade53e4bd031cecd196c0621
address
bc1qt0azdnjtf0lj4t098e9aqvwwe5vkcp3pvkh8m3
transaction
3828f766fffede67b5bbcba2a768bd6fce5b292ca2d7eefdeb5faa80f93b1589
confirmations
20075
spent
true